14 hours ago, themagician said:

The biggest change was the queue, as Fast Track has been moved. The FT used to go to the right, but now goes left, runs around the edge of the hall and up the left of the hallway, so now guests queue on the right. The station has been modified slightly to accomodate this change, so now the FT queue leads right to the loading area, rather that right next to the standard queue.

Is there any new updates to the sdsc?

I rode about a week ago.

- The archway as you round the corner to the station platform needs re-painting. It's been like this forever and I don't understand why it wasn't fixed last refurb. 

- The ride itself looked as shit as ever. Blades swing overhead but are in the dark. 

- looks like some walls have been fitted here and there but they are just black painted flat board and look temporary, possibly just to further darken the dark ride area.

- Main Laser was out. Only laser was to the left of the first brake in the main room. I never noticed 1 there before.

- you could see a pile of boxes on the floor in the main room. Possibly storing original figures waiting to be reinstalled.

It's so disappointing to see the ride like this and I hope it gets some love soon.
